    ✅ ✅ Yes, the content seems to be true and authentic, as reported by several sources.

    These, include

    1. https://p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/articles/PMC12339444/ - (Trust Score 9/10)

    - Study shows females scored higher in Mediterranean diet adherence, excelling in 7 food items like reduced red meat, more vegetables and olive oil, while males did better in fish, legumes, and sweets.

    2. https://p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/articles/PMC10782790/ - (Trust Score 9/10)

    - Research finds females have higher MD adherence and prefer vegetables, fruits, legumes, fish, nuts over red meats compared to males, linked to lower cardiovascular risk.

    3. https://www.frontiersin.org/journals/nutrition/articles/10.3389/fnut.2024.1501646/full - (Trust Score 8/10)

    - Systematic review notes gender differences in diet patterns, with women consuming more fruits/vegetables and men more animal protein, though some studies show mixed or no differences.
